**Night Shift — Recording Studio (Room 4B)**

The Fennick Media training studio runs unattended overnight. Check the booking sheet before entering. Power down lights and teleprompter after any maintenance. Do not move camera rigs; they are marked on the floor. Report faults in the night log, not by phone. Lock the equipment cage before leaving. The studio door uses a keypad; enter with the code below.

badge for fahap-kahof: bdg-EQUNTN-00774017

## Blue-green deploys: Ledgerbee billing worker

Reviewers: confirm both color stacks read the same invoice queue before approving. Cutover flips the Tallow router flag; no worker restarts needed. Rollback is the same flag reversed. Each color has its own env file; keep them in sync manually for now. The payment gateway credential for the green stack goes on the next line.

env line for yahip-tafog: RELAY_SECRET3=4ca

## Ownership

Welcome aboard! The Glimmerbay consent banner rollout is a bit of a beast — it touches the web shell, the mobile wrapper, and the regional policy configs, so don't ship changes solo until you've done at least one paired review. Rollout percentages live in the `bannerstage` config and only the owner bumps them. If the banner vanishes or double-fires in Pellworth-region builds, that's a known flaky test, not you. The person on the hook for all of it is listed right here.

account owner for fajep-yagef: Kasix Eliiel

**Ticket: Config drift on BounceSift processor**

The email bounce processor in the Larkfield environment has drifted from the values committed in the release branch. Retry windows and suppression thresholds no longer match, which likely explains the duplicate suppression entries reported Tuesday. Please reconcile before the Thursday cut. For reference, the currently deployed configuration on the live node reads as follows.

config for yajep-yahof:
[briax]
port = 9200
region = outer-2
host = briax.nelvrocorp.test
team = raleth
timeout_ms = 1500
retries = 1